1. Job Title and Overview
Job Title: Commercial Manager
Department: Commercial / Business Operations
Reports To: Managing Director / Director
Job Overview:
The Commercial Manager will be responsible for leading and managing the commercial activities of MEDSEC LIMITED, ensuring the company remains competitive, financially sustainable, and strategically positioned within the security and safety services sector. The role involves overseeing contracts, supporting business development, managing client relationships, and ensuring that all commercial agreements align with the company’s operational objectives and compliance requirements. The Commercial Manager will work closely with senior leadership to drive revenue growth, enhance service delivery, and support long-term organisational success.
2. Essential Job Functions
Key Responsibilities
Develop and implement commercial strategies to support business growth and profitability.
Manage client contracts, negotiate service agreements, and ensure favourable commercial terms for the company.
Identify new business opportunities and support tender preparation, bids, and contract acquisition.
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, partners, and key stakeholders.
Prepare budgets, cost analyses, and financial forecasts to support strategic decision-making.
Monitor contract performance to ensure services are delivered in accordance with agreed terms and quality standards.
Work collaboratively with operations teams to align commercial objectives with service delivery.
Analyse market trends and competitor activity to strengthen MEDSEC LIMITED’s market position.
Ensure compliance with industry regulations, company policies, and commercial best practices.
Prepare regular commercial reports, risk assessments, and performance updates for senior management.
Support pricing strategies and resource planning to maximise operational efficiency and profitability.
3. Education and Experience
Required
Bachelor’s degree or equivalent qualification in Business Administration, Commercial Management, Finance, Marketing, or a related field.
Minimum 5 years’ experience in a commercial, business development, or contract management role.
Proven track record in contract negotiation, revenue generation, and client relationship management.
Licenses / Certifications
Professional certification in Commercial or Project Management (preferred).
Membership of a recognised professional body such as CIPS, CIM, or IoD (advantageous).
Preferred Qualifications
Experience working within the security, facilities management, or service-based industry.
Strong financial and analytical skills with a solid understanding of cost control and profit management.
Excellent negotiation, leadership, and strategic planning abilities.
